ZIP Code 30560: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 30560?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 30560 is $321,300, higher than 72%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 30560?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 30560 is $1,033, an effective rate of 0%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 30560 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 30560 cost about 4.87× the median household income, higher than 84%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the average rent in ZIP Code 30560?
- The median gross rent in ZIP Code 30560 is $1,006 a month, higher than 60%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much have home prices grown in ZIP Code 30560?
- Home prices in ZIP Code 30560 have moved 68% over the past five years (4.4% in the past year), per the FHFA House Price Index.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 30560?
- ZIP Code 30560 averages 55.9°F year-round, summer highs near 83.6°F, winter lows around 27.3°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 3.1 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 30560 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 30560's FEMA National Risk Index score is 85.8 (higher than 79%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is tornado.
